Embodiment 1

[0023] figure 1 In order to implement a specific technical solution of the present invention, it is only used to give a specific description of the present invention, so that those skilled in the art can better understand and implement the present invention.

[0024] figure 1 in,

[0025] 1. Collecting and protecting parts: a cylindrical container with a diameter of 20cm and a height of 40cm without a cover and a bottom, as the protection part of the collecting part, buried in the ground to be tested.

[0026] 2. Supporting parts: the bottom of the cylindrical container without cover and bottom is evenly distributed and welded with fixed brackets with a height of 10cm as the supporting part to stabilize the bottomless cylindrical container without cover.

Abstract

The invention discloses a leakage measuring instrument, which comprises a leakage collecting component, a supporting component, a collection protecting component, a drainage component and a leakage measuring component. The leakage measuring instrument is characterized by also comprising a filtering component. The supporting component is arranged at the bottom of the collection protecting component; and the leakage collecting component, the filtering component and the drainage component are arranged in the collection protecting component, wherein the drainage component and the leakage collecting component are combined together, and the leakage measuring component measures the water drained by the drainage component. The leakage measuring instrument has the advantages of small volume, low cost, convenient installation and portability; and the measuring method is simple and has high precision. The leakage measuring instrument can be directly arranged at a certain depth of any position of the farmland, and realize timely, quantitative and intuitional automatic measurement of leaked water in a deep layer.

Description

Technical field [0001] The invention relates to a leakage measuring instrument and a method for measuring the deep layer leakage of farmland by using the leakage measuring instrument, which is suitable for the fields of irrigation quality evaluation, irrigation scientific research and environmental protection. Background technique [0002] Rainfall or irrigation causes deep leakage that exceeds the soil plan wet layer field water holding rate, which is an important part of farmland water cycle. Accurate determination of leakage is to determine groundwater replenishment, evaluate irrigation quality and environmental effects, formulate a reasonable irrigation system and Calculate important basic data such as crop water requirements. At present, the recharge of groundwater by measuring leakage is mainly obtained by measuring the water level of observation wells, and the experimental observation of leakage is mainly obtained by lysimeter or bottomed measuring pit.
